返回

为你的 Web 项目无缝集成腾讯 IM

前端

用 iframe 集成腾讯 IM

在 Web 项目中集成腾讯 IM 是一种直观且高效的方法。iframe(内联框架)允许您在网页中嵌入外部内容,在本例中,我们将使用 iframe 来加载腾讯 IM 控件。

步骤 1:获取 Tencent IM 脚本

首先,您需要获取 Tencent IM 脚本。您可以从腾讯 IM 官网下载最新版本。

步骤 2:创建 iframe

在您的 HTML 文件中,创建以下 iframe 元素:

<iframe id="tencent-im" src="tencent-im-script.js"></iframe>

tencent-im-script.js 替换为腾讯 IM 脚本的路径。

步骤 3:配置 iframe

您可以使用以下属性来配置 iframe:

  • allow="microphone; camera": 允许访问麦克风和摄像头,以便进行语音和视频通话。
  • allowfullscreen: 允许 iframe 占据整个屏幕。
  • frameBorder="0": 隐藏 iframe 边框。

步骤 4:与 iframe 交互

您可以使用 JavaScript 与 iframe 中的腾讯 IM 控件进行交互。使用 getElementById() 方法获取 iframe 元素,然后使用 contentWindow 属性访问 iframe 中的内容:

const iframe = document.getElementById('tencent-im');
const im = iframe.contentWindow;

现在,您可以调用 im 对象上的方法来控制腾讯 IM。

实践场景

使用 iframe 集成腾讯 IM 为 Web 项目提供了广泛的可能性。以下是两个常见的使用场景:

客服: 将腾讯 IM 集成到您的客服系统中,使您的客户可以通过即时聊天与您的团队联系。这提供了一种快速、便捷的客户支持方式。

聊天: 在您的 Web 应用程序中添加聊天功能,允许用户彼此进行交流。这在协作平台和社交网络中尤为有用。

结论

将腾讯 IM 集成到 Web 项目中是一种功能强大的技术,可以显著增强您的应用程序的功能。通过使用 iframe 方法,您可以轻松、快速地加载腾讯 IM 控件,并使用 JavaScript 与其进行交互。

在本文中,我们概述了将腾讯 IM 集成到 Web 项目的步骤,并探讨了两种常见的使用场景。遵循这些指南,您可以为您的用户提供无缝的即时通信体验。